Soak the cashew in warm milk
Slice the onions
Cut the tomatoes in large pieces
Remove the skin of garlic and ginger
Heat 2tsp oil in a pan
Now saute the onions and garlic till it charges colour
and the raw smell disappears
Now add the tomatoes and continue to cook till it
becomes a little mushy
Now add the turmeric, chillipowder, coriander and
cumin powder and continue to cook on a low flame for 5 minutes.
Switch off the fire and let it cool completely
Now transfer the cooked onion and tomato mixture to
the jar of the mixer.
Add the giner to this and grind it into a smooth
paste
Grind the cahew milk mixture into a smooth paste too
Now heat the same pan with the reaining oil on a low
heat
Pour this ground onion tomato mixture into it. Add
salt, garam masala and mix well
Add enough water to make it into the required consistency
and quantity
Add tofu and let it cook for few minutes
Now add the cashew paste and kasuri methi, mix well . Let it cook for 2
minutes. Switch off the fire
Serve warm with chapathi/ pulka/ roti
